By Product Type

Butt Hinges:

Butt hinges are among the most traditional types of hinges used in furniture applications. They are typically mounted on the edge of two surfaces, facilitating smooth swinging motion. These hinges are known for their straightforward design and ease of installation, making them a popular choice for both residential and commercial furniture. Butt hinges are available in various sizes and materials, allowing manufacturers to select the optimal option for specific furniture pieces. Their durability and ability to support heavy doors and lids contribute significantly to their sustained use across diverse applications.

Concealed Hinges:

Concealed hinges, also known as hidden hinges, are designed to be invisible when the door or lid is closed. This aesthetic appeal makes them a favored choice for modern furniture designs where visual cleanliness is essential. They provide a seamless look while still offering robust functionality. Concealed hinges are particularly popular in cabinet applications, as they offer an unobtrusive solution that enhances both the design and usability. Moreover, advancements in concealed hinge technology have improved their strength and ease of installation, further boosting their market presence.

Piano Hinges:

Piano hinges, or continuous hinges, are characterized by their long and narrow design, allowing them to run the entire length of an opening. This type of hinge is exceptionally strong and provides uniform support, making them ideal for larger furniture pieces and applications such as piano lids, hence the name. Their continuous structure helps distribute weight evenly, minimizing wear and tear over time. Additionally, piano hinges are available in various materials and finishes, which appeals to a range of aesthetic preferences, enhancing their adoption in both commercial and residential furniture settings.

Continuous Hinges:

Continuous hinges are similar to piano hinges and are designed to provide strength and stability across a full length. They are particularly useful for heavy doors, lids, or panels that require consistent support. Their design allows for easy installation and maintenance, making them popular in institutional and industrial furniture. Continuous hinges are engineered to handle substantial weight and frequent use without compromising functionality, making them an essential component in high-traffic environments. Their versatility in design allows them to blend seamlessly into various styles of furniture.

Barrel Hinges:

Barrel hinges, also known as pin hinges, are cylindrical in shape and are typically used for lighter applications. They consist of two parts that fit together, allowing rotation around a single axis. Barrel hinges are often utilized in small cabinets, jewelry boxes, and decorative furniture pieces where aesthetic elements are as crucial as functionality. They offer a minimalist design that is both pleasing to the eye and efficient in function. Their compact size and ease of installation make them an attractive option for manufacturers looking to create elegant furniture designs without compromising on quality.

By Material Type

Steel:

Steel is one of the most widely used materials for furniture hinges due to its exceptional strength and durability. It is particularly favored in applications that require heavy-duty performance, such as industrial and commercial furniture. Steel hinges are resistant to deformation and wear, making them ideal for high-traffic areas. Additionally, advancements in coating technologies have enhanced the rust-resistance of steel hinges, increasing their appeal in various environments. The versatility and strength of steel make it a vital material in the furniture hinge market.

Brass:

Brass hinges are often selected for their aesthetic appeal and corrosion resistance. This material offers a warm, golden hue that enhances the visual appeal of furniture, making it a popular choice in decorative applications. Brass hinges are commonly used in residential furniture, particularly in traditional and vintage designs. Their ability to develop a patina over time adds character to furniture pieces. Although they may not provide the same level of strength as steel, their unique properties make them an attractive option for certain applications where appearance is paramount.

Stainless Steel:

Stainless steel hinges are recognized for their durability, corrosion resistance, and low maintenance requirements, making them ideal for various applications. They are widely used in environments subject to moisture, such as kitchens and bathrooms, where exposure to humidity can lead to rust and deterioration of other materials. Stainless steel hinges also offer a modern and industrial look, appealing to contemporary furniture designs. Their combination of strength and aesthetic versatility ensures that they remain a popular choice across multiple sectors.

Zinc:

Zinc hinges are lightweight and provide excellent corrosion resistance, making them suitable for use in environments that may experience moisture or humidity. They are often used in applications where cost-effectiveness is a priority. Zinc-coated hinges are recognized for their ability to withstand environmental challenges while maintaining functionality. Although they may not offer the same strength as steel or stainless steel, their affordability and resistance to corrosion make them a viable option for many furniture applications.

Aluminum:

Aluminum hinges are known for their lightweight nature and resistance to corrosion, making them ideal for applications requiring portability and ease of handling. They are commonly used in outdoor furniture, RVs, and other applications where weight is a significant factor. While aluminum lacks the strength of steel, its lightweight characteristics can be advantageous in specific contexts. Additionally, aluminum can be anodized or painted in various colors, providing manufacturers with design flexibility and aesthetic options for their products.
